What Is a Human Biology Major?
A human biology major is a specialized undergraduate degree that focuses exclusively on the biology of humans. Unlike a general biology degree that covers plants, animals, and ecosystems, this major zeroes in on human anatomy, physiology, genetics, and development. You will study how cells communicate, how organs work together, and how genetic variations influence health and disease.
The curriculum typically includes core courses in:
- Human anatomy and physiology
- Cell and molecular biology
- Genetics and genomics
- Biochemistry
- Immunology and microbiology
- Epidemiology and public health
- Evolutionary biology and human adaptation
Many programs also require laboratory work, where you learn techniques like PCR, microscopy, and cell culture. This hands-on training prepares you for real world applications in medicine, research, and health sciences.
Why Choose This Major? Career Paths and Opportunities
A human biology major opens doors to a wide range of careers. Because the degree emphasizes the science of human health, it is an excellent choice for pre-medical, pre-dental, and pre-physician assistant students. But even if you are not planning to go to medical school, the skills you gain are highly valued in many fields.
Here are some common career paths for human biology graduates:
| Career Path | Typical Roles | Additional Requirements | | :-, | :-, | :-, | | Healthcare | Doctor, dentist, physician assistant, nurse | Graduate or professional school | | Research | Lab technician, research associate, PhD scientist | Master’s or PhD | | Biotechnology | Product development, quality control, sales | Bachelor’s or Master’s | | Public Health | Epidemiologist, health educator, policy analyst | Master’s in Public Health | | Education | High school teacher, science communicator | Teaching certification or graduate degree |
The major also provides a strong foundation for graduate studies in biomedical sciences, bioinformatics, or genetic counseling. Because human biology is so relevant to current health challenges like pandemics, chronic diseases, and aging, job growth in these areas is expected to remain strong.
Key Skills You Will Develop
Beyond memorizing facts, a human biology major teaches you how to think like a scientist. You will develop a set of transferable skills that employers and graduate schools value highly.
- Critical thinking and problem solving: You learn to analyze complex biological data, interpret research findings, and design experiments.
- Laboratory proficiency: Hands-on training in techniques like ELISA, DNA extraction, and histology prepares you for bench work.
- Communication: You will write lab reports, present research findings, and explain scientific concepts to diverse audiences.
- Quantitative analysis: Courses often include biostatistics and data interpretation, essential for evidence based practice.
- Teamwork and collaboration: Many programs include group projects and team based research, mimicking real world scientific environments.
These skills are not just for the lab. They translate directly to roles in healthcare management, science journalism, and regulatory affairs.
How to Succeed as a Human Biology Major
Success in this major requires more than just attending lectures. Here are practical tips to maximize your learning and career readiness.
1. Get involved in undergraduate research. Seek out a faculty mentor and join a lab early. Research experience strengthens your resume and clarifies your career interests. Many universities offer summer research programs or independent study credits.
2. Build a strong foundation in chemistry and math. Human biology is heavily integrated with biochemistry and molecular biology. A solid understanding of organic chemistry and statistics will make advanced courses much easier.
3. Network with professionals. Attend career fairs, join pre-health clubs, and talk to alumni in your field. These connections can lead to internships, shadowing opportunities, and job offers.
4. Consider a minor or double major. Pairing human biology with public health, psychology, or data science can make you more competitive for specific roles. For example, a minor in bioinformatics is excellent for genomics research.
5. Stay current with scientific news. Follow journals like Nature or Science, and subscribe to newsletters from the National Institutes of Health. Understanding emerging trends like CRISPR, personalized medicine, and microbiome research will give you an edge in interviews and discussions.
